Output 20b6dd386d267970f836ee921b3bd760dd52c5063160ce4a37893441898a68e8:0

value
517921216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f70175462a63ea1aedeabb4d2a2673a95ad0ad OP_EQUAL
address
MHCJP4Xinaj7CN1yHogMyotYCHGUknNm6Q
transaction
20b6dd386d267970f836ee921b3bd760dd52c5063160ce4a37893441898a68e8
spent
true